ABC will bench Thursday staple Ugly Betty in favor of a comedy hour starting March 26, the network announced on Monday. Betty, played by America Ferrera (pictured), has struggled in the ratings recently, though execs promise the show will return later in the season. The comedy, Motherhood, starring Megan Mullally (Will & Grace) and Cheryl Hines (Curb Your Enthusiasm), is based on a Web series about two buddies. It will be followed by new episodes of Samantha Who? ABC also announced yesterday that another new comedy, Better Off Ted, starring Ellen's girlfriend Portia de Rossi, will air Wednesdays.
